Methanol, by way of example, absorbs at wavelengths beneath 205 nm, and h2o under a hundred ninety nm. For those who ended up utilizing a methanol-water combination as being the solvent, you would probably hence really have to utilize a wavelength increased than 205 nm in order to avoid Bogus readings in the solvent.
